Subject: [PATCH] cifs: do not share tcp servers with dfs mounts
Git-commit: f3c852b0b0fc0e4ecabbf2e8480c2a088d54b588
References: bsc#1185902
Patch-mainline: v5.14-rc1
It isn't enough to have unshared tcons because multiple DFS mounts can
connect to same target server and failover to different servers, so we
can't use a single tcp server for such cases.
For the simplest solution, use nosharesock option to achieve that.
